2024 Compare Cities Religion:
Southern Pines, NC vs Asheboro, NC

Change Cities
Highlights
- People living in Asheboro are 16.6% less likely to have a religous affiliation, than people living in Southern Pines
 Southern Pines, NCAsheboro, NCUnited States
 Percent Religious52.1%35.5%49.4%
 Baptist15.8%12.2%8.2%
 Episcopalian1.0%0.2%0.6%
 Catholic6.6%0.5%19.7%
 Church of Jesus Christ0.7%0.4%2.1%
 Lutheran1.1%0.0%2.4%
 Pentecostal0.7%2.1%1.9%
 Methodist10.6%9.8%4.0%
 Presbyterian6.9%1.5%1.7%
 Other Christian8.3%8.5%6.7%
 Judaism0.3%0.0%0.7%
 Eastern0.0%0.0%0.5%
 Islam0.0%0.2%0.9%
